C语言 fscanf eof
WebDec 25, 2024 · 缓冲文件系统中,关键的概念是“文件类型指针” fscanf读取一行字符串 ,简称“文件指针”。. 每个被使用的文件都在内存中开辟了一个相应的文件信息区,. 用来存放文件的相关信息(如文件的名字,文件状态及 文件当前的位置等)。. 这些信息是保存在一个 ... Web/* fscanf example */ #include int main () { char str [80]; float f; FILE * pFile; pFile = fopen ("myfile.txt","w+"); fprintf (pFile, "%f %s", 3.1416, "PI"); rewind (pFile); fscanf …
C语言 fscanf eof
Did you know?
WebJan 3, 2014 · fscanf 严格按照 数据 类型来 读取 ,如果是要 读取 并保存在double类型的 数据 a里面,则占位符应该是%lf。. 建议加上换行符 FILE *p =fopen ("./fp.txt","r"); double a; int cnt; while (!feof (p)) { fscanf (p, "%lf\n",&a); c. matlab 数据 流,写入和 读取数据 - MATLAB & Simulink - MathWorks 中国 ... Web后面才知道,其实是文件最后会有一个eof字符,文件指针不到eof的话,feof就不会判断为空,而我们读的时候,指针会停在读取的最后一个字上面,那当我们读完 李信 70的时候,指针其实是指在0这里的,而不是eof字符,那么再进行第4次判断的时候(也就是读完李信之后的while判断)feof是认为未空的 ...
Webc 文件读写 上一章我们讲解了 c 语言处理的标准输入和输出设备。本章我们将介绍 c 程序员如何创建、打开、关闭文本文件或二进制文件。 一个文件,无论它是文本文件还是二进制文件,都是代表了一系列的字节。c 语言不仅提供了访问顶层的函数,也提供了底层(os)调用来处理存储设备上的文件。 WebC语言fprintf()和fscanf()函数 以下内容仅是站长或网友个人学习笔记、总结和研究收藏。 ... 函数用于从文件中读取一组字符。它从文件读取一个单词,并在文件结尾返回EOF。 fscanf() ...
Web1. %e: This placeholder in C is used to read the floating numbers. But in scientific notation. for e.g>> 2.04000e+01. 2. %f: This placeholder in C language is used to read the floating numbers as well but this will be in a … WebJul 7, 2015 · 常常遇到这段代码, while (scanf ("%d",&num)!=EOF) {...} ,对于 EOF 以及 scanf 函数的返回值始终没有好好研究过,本文将对这个问题进行一下简单的剖析。. 【正 …
http://c.biancheng.net/view/2073.html
WebJan 30, 2015 · while(fscanf(m,"%d",&data[i++])!=EOF); And checking if i < size is also a good idea. Share. Improve this answer. Follow answered Jan 30, 2015 at 10:05. reader reader. 496 2 2 silver badges 15 15 bronze badges. 0. Add a comment Your Answer Thanks for contributing an answer to Stack Overflow! Please be sure to answer ... song crying holy unto the lordWebApr 2, 2024 · linux c ioctl 设置本地ip 子网掩码网络信息在日常开发中除了设置网络信息外,路由的设置也是不可避免的,同样仍然使用ioctl万能函数设置,获取设备属性,首先认识下路由属性核心结构: struct rtentry { unsigned… small electric pot for soupWebc语言中的fscanf()函数 ... 赋值,如果原来i有值,那值不变,如果原来没有赋值,那会是一个任意数。而n此时即为EOF,即-1。 fscanf函数的正确调用形式是 ... small electric portable smokerWeb原因:这个代码是从输入流里面获取整型数据,如果你输入一个字符型的,scanf不拿这个字符的数据出来,这个数据就一直在缓存里,最后就导致了死循环。 如果这个缓冲区在栈内分配的,我们是不用管的,之前有个文章说过,栈主要是有操作系统管理的,但是如果这个缓冲区在堆内分配,我们就 ... song cryptonightWeb函数名: feof. 头文件 :. 用 法: int feof (FILE *stream); 功 能: 检测流上的文件结束符。. 检测到文件尾标记EOF或Ctrl-z都为文件结束符。. 参数 : stream为要检测的流. 返回值 : 成功 返回非零值 ,失败 返回0。. 补充 : feof判断文件结束是通过读取函数fread/fscanf等 ... small electric plug in heatersWebSep 29, 2024 · 因为C语言标准规定scanf在输入在首个接收用参数赋值前发生失败则返回EOF,而并没有强制规定EOF必须定义为-1。 你同学的观点是对的。 提供scanf这种标 … song cry yeonjun lyricsWebc file 为什么fscanf只从文件中读取一个字符串的第一个字,c,file,scanf,C,File,Scanf,当我试图用fscanf()读取结构的文件信息时,我遇到了一个问题。 它只读取字符串的第一行,循环永远不会结束。 song cube storytime